python - shapefile在哪个模块中定义

标签 python python-3.x

我想运行this example 。它在第一行失败:

$ python3
>>> import shapefile
ModuleNotFoundError: No module named 'shapefile'

显然shapefile不在标准库中。当我 search in PyPi我得到了结果,但在第一个结果中没有提供 import shapefile,因此不清楚这是否适合我。

我是否在这里遗漏了一些东西,我应该在没有任何推理的情况下尝试 PyPi 搜索中的所有匹配项吗?我有点迷失在这里......

最佳答案

我认为您正在查看的页面可能已过时。

首先在命令行上运行pip install pyshp。然后在 Python 提示符下导入 shapefile

这对我在 Python 3.5.6 上有效。

https://pypi.org/project/pyshp/

关于python - shapefile在哪个模块中定义,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56361642/

相关文章:

python - 使用Python操作Excel电子表格

python - 如何处理没有结尾斜杠的空 HTML 元素?

python - 为什么 numpy 1.14 将 float16 65504 舍入到 65500

python - UDP 服务器帧间隙

python - 仅获取 numpy 数组中每一行的特定列

python - 如何从 Julia 加载 python pickle?

python-3.x - 每次按下键时如何获得随机项目?

python - 有没有办法将 unicode 编码成人类可读的 base64 变体(在 python 中)

python-3.x - 属性错误: 'module' object has no attribute 'ensure_future'

python-3.x - Gekko 中间变量,错误 : equation without equality or inequality